Understanding the Material: A Key to Success

Carhartt beanies are typically crafted from durable materials like acrylic, wool, or a blend of both. These materials can be somewhat resistant to stretching, but with the right techniques, you can achieve the desired results without damaging the fabric.

Method 1: The Gentle Steam Approach

Steam is a versatile tool for loosening fibers and relaxing fabric. This method is ideal for those who prefer a gentler approach to stretching their beanies:

1. Fill a pot with water and bring it to a boil. The steam generated will be the key to loosening the fibers.
2. Hold the beanie over the steaming water, ensuring it doesn’t touch the water directly. Keep a safe distance to avoid burning yourself.
3. Use your hands to gently stretch the beanie in the desired directions. Focus on areas where you need the most expansion.
4. Continue steaming for a few minutes, periodically stretching the beanie. The steam will help loosen the fibers, making the stretching process more effective.
5. Let the beanie cool completely before wearing it. This allows the fabric to set in its new shape.

Method 2: The Wet Towel Technique

This method utilizes the power of moisture to relax the fibers and allow for stretching:

1. Fill a bowl with warm water and soak a clean towel in it. The water should be warm but not hot.
2. Wring out the excess water from the towel. You want it to be damp but not dripping wet.
3. Wrap the damp towel around the beanie, ensuring it’s completely covered. The towel’s moisture will penetrate the beanie’s fabric.
4. Gently stretch the beanie in the desired directions while it’s wrapped in the towel. Focus on areas that need more expansion.
5. Leave the beanie wrapped in the damp towel for about 30 minutes. This allows the moisture to work its magic on the fibers.
6. Unwrap the beanie and let it air dry completely. Avoid using heat to dry it, as this could shrink the beanie back to its original size.

Method 3: The Strategic Stretching Approach

This method involves direct stretching of the beanie using your hands:

1. Start by gently pulling on the beanie’s crown. This will help to stretch the top of the beanie.
2. Next, stretch the beanie’s brim by pulling it outwards. Focus on areas where you need more expansion.
3. Continue stretching the beanie in all directions, paying attention to areas that feel tight. Be gentle but firm with your stretching.
4. Repeat the stretching process for a few minutes. The more you stretch the beanie, the more it will loosen up.
5. Allow the beanie to rest for a few hours after stretching. This will help the fabric to retain its new shape.

Method 4: The Cold Water Soak

This method involves soaking the beanie in cold water to relax the fibers:

1. Fill a bowl with cold water and submerge the beanie in it. Make sure the beanie is completely submerged.
2. Let the beanie soak in the cold water for about 30 minutes. This will allow the fibers to relax and become more pliable.
3. Remove the beanie from the water and gently squeeze out any excess water. Avoid wringing or twisting the beanie, as this could damage the fabric.
4. Lay the beanie flat on a clean towel and let it air dry completely. Avoid using heat to dry it, as this could shrink the beanie back to its original size.

Method 5: The Hair Dryer Trick

This is a quick and effective method for stretching out a beanie, but it requires caution:

1. Put on the beanie and adjust it to the desired fit. Make sure the beanie is snug but not too tight.
2. Use a hair dryer on a low heat setting to gently warm the areas of the beanie that need stretching. Avoid holding the hair dryer directly on the fabric for too long, as this could damage it.
3. As you warm the beanie, gently stretch it in the desired directions. Focus on areas that feel tight.
4. Once the beanie has been stretched to your desired fit, let it cool completely. Avoid touching or manipulating the beanie while it’s still warm.

Top Questions Asked

Q: Can I use a washing machine to stretch out my Carhartt beanie?
A: It’s not recommended to use a washing machine to stretch out your beanie. The agitation and heat of the washing machine can damage the fabric and potentially shrink the beanie further.

Q: How long will the stretched fit last?
A: The stretched fit will typically last for a good amount of time, but it may gradually return to its original shape over time, especially if the beanie is washed frequently.

Q: Can I use a steamer to stretch out my beanie?
A: Yes, a steamer can be used to stretch out your beanie. However, be careful not to hold the steamer too close to the fabric, as this could damage it.

Q: Is it okay to stretch out a beanie made from a blend of materials?
A: Yes, most beanie blends can be stretched using the methods outlined above. However, if you’re unsure, it’s always best to test a small, inconspicuous area of the beanie first.

Q: What if my beanie is too big after stretching?
A: If your beanie is too big after stretching, you can try shrinking it back down by washing it in hot water and drying it on a high heat setting. However, this method can damage the fabric, so it’s best to use it as a last resort.
